The Role

Deliver pre-planned lessons and learning activities across Key Stages 1 and 2 in the absence of the regular teacher
Provide targeted support to individuals and small groups to enhance understanding and progress
Support teachers with lesson planning, preparation, and assessment where required
Promote positive behaviour and maintain an engaging and inclusive learning environment
Monitor and record student progress, providing feedback to teaching staff
